| Blake Huber Returns To Brand New School as Flame Artist and Lead CompositorAugust 15, 2011 -- Jonathan Notaro and his colleagues at international production company and design studio Brand New School (BNS) are very proud to announce the appointment of Blake Huber to the position of Flame artist and lead compositor for their East Coast studio. Since 2007 Blake has been a VFX artist for Charlex in New York, and prior to that, he spent six years with BNS East as an animator and Flame artist. Adams joins Original after a ten-year run at Los Angeles-based Form where he directed campaigns for Bud Light, AT&T, Home Depot, Snickers and many other national brands. | Corinne Bogdanowicz Joins Light Iron Team As DI ColoristBogdanowicz Colors Soderbergh's "Haywire"August 01, 2011 -- Light Iron announces that Corinne Bogdanowicz has joined the Light Iron team as a DI Colorist at its new facility in Hollywood. Bogdanowicz comes to Light Iron from DreamWorks Animation, where she re-mastered the first three installments of the Shrek franchise and Ku Fu Panda for stereo conversion. Prior to Dreamworks, she worked in the feature film and trailer DI departments at post facilities Prime Focus and Pacific Title. | | | |
